  2. I put, a few years ago, a Fender Custom Shop 69 set in my strato. CS69´s are a vintage low gain pups, to compense this I put all pups higher that I can.

    The results sounds great till 10th fret, at this point to the end of scale, in all strings, when played sounds the main note and a ghost note, like a bad octave was conected to the guitar. I disassembly the guitar about 4 times, leveling the frets twice, remake the eletrical conections one time and nothing change: the ghost note was always there. And may clearance gone to hell, this ghost note dirt completly the sound.

    When I decide to remove the pups I begin to down then, thinking "this not gona happen" so I plug the guitar with pups completly down and for my surprise the sound was perfectly! The final setup was made with the neck position completly down, the middle a little bit higher and the bridge position completly high.

    Well all this to ask you if you don´t try do drop the neck position pup. In my case the alnico magnets was to strong that causes this deformation in the sound.

    I usually do the tenon in this way, more PRS than Gibson for a few reasons.

    First it has a greater gluing surface area, which in my opinion makes a stronger joint, and I believe that it increases the propagation of sound by improving the sustain of the instrument. Myth? I don´t know but it works fine and sounds great at the end!

    Second it is easier to build, and that way I can do a confort line on neck heel , see the topic of Lespaul Paul Gold Top that I build some time ago.

    About the few clamps to attach the board, think that its enough, I will clamping until de glue squezes when it stops I stop too, till today all fretboards are in the rigth place! kekeek
